Duct Booster Fan
Model DB2
The DB-2 DUCT BOOSTER® is designed to increase
the flow of heated air in warm air heating systems, or cooled air in central air
conditioning systems. Its size and design limits its use to branch ducts serving
individual rooms, not the main supply or “truck line” duct. The DUCT BOOSTER®
can be mounted on round or flat ducts. It is frequently installed on a warm air
duct of a gravity warm air furnace to provide heating for a basement area. Duct
Booster Fans can be installed in existing supply ducts to boost air flow into
hard-to-heat or cool rooms or they are the efficient, economical way to exhaust
unwanted heat, humidity, odors or other air-borne contaminates.
Features:
- For boosting air flow in heating or air
conditioning ducts, or for powered ambient air intake or exhaust
- Easy installation in both round and
rectangular ducts. Can be installed in a section of metal duct and spliced
into a section of flex duct
- Installs in round metal ducts from 5” - 8”
diameter or rectangular ducts as shallow as 3 1/4”
- Maximum ambient room temp. 100° F
- Maximum duct air temp. 200° F
- Rated for heated and cooled air
- Heavy gauge housing

Table is based on straight metal duct. 90
degree elbows are equivalent to 10 feet of straight duct. Performance is based
on 70 degrees F standard air.
